Cudell blends residential calm with city convenience on the west side of Cleveland, offering leafy streets, classic architecture, and easy commuting. The Red Line at the West Boulevard–Cudell Station puts downtown and the airport within a quick ride, while Detroit and Madison avenues carry you to local cafes, markets, and services. Many homes here feature early-20th-century details—front porches, brick facades, and broad lots—paired with the practicality of garages, yards, and nearby transit.
Weekends are effortless. Fitness and youth programs at the Cudell Recreation Center keep activity close to home, and the neighborhood’s pocket greens and Cudell Commons invite picnics or a quiet stroll. Just minutes away, Detroit-Shoreway brings theater and galleries, while the lakefront around Edgewater delivers sandy beaches and skyline sunsets. Head west into Lakewood for even more independent eateries and shops.
Families appreciate the area’s education options, including nearby Marion C. Seltzer School within the Cleveland Metropolitan School District and additional choices across West Boulevard. Daily life feels straightforward—walkable blocks, frequent buses, and a strong sense of neighborhood pride shaped by long-time residents and newcomers alike.
